<h2>The unit digit of the square of 572 is 4</h2>
Step-by-step explanation:
In this problem, we are expected to tell what number is at the unit position of the square of 572.
firstly, what is the square of 572.
this is gotten as = 572^2
=572*572
=327184
from the result, the value at the unit position is 4
The unit digit of the square of 572 is 4

For the sequence each term is obtained by multiplying the preceding term by 2.
3, 6, 12, 24, 48, 96, 192
Therefore, the next three terms are 48, 96 and 192.
